SOFTWARE DEVELOPMENT - AN OVERVIEW

Software Development - An Overview

Software Development - An Overview

Blog Article

The sources of Thoughts for software goods are plentiful. These Suggestions can come from marketplace exploration including the demographics of likely new prospects, existing customers, product sales prospects who turned down the item, other interior software development team, or a Imaginative third party. Concepts for software solutions tend to be very first evaluated by internet marketing staff for economic feasibility, suit with existing channels of distribution, attainable effects on present product lines, demanded attributes, and suit with the corporate's advertising targets.

Your electronic Certification will probably be additional for your Achievements website page - from there, you can print your Certificate or increase it in your LinkedIn profile. If you only desire to examine and view the system information, you are able to audit the system without cost.

Microservices A microservices architecture, also just known as “microservices”, is an approach to building an software as being a series of independently deployable products and services that are decentralized and autonomously made. These solutions are loosely coupled, independently deployable, and simply maintainable.

Good quality Assurance (QA) Engineer: The QA e­ngineer is liable­ for screening and ensuring the quality and operation of software­. They thoroughly structure te­st instances, execute­ assessments, and diligently report any de­fects to the deve­lopment crew.

CD extends this process by automating software supply to generation or staging environments, letting for swift and responsible release cycles, decreasing handbook intervention, and enhancing the general high-quality and velocity of software development and deployment.

They might work on a smaller scale than engineers, specializing in a distinct segment like cell applications or the net of Matters (IoT). Software engineers may possibly orchestrate software architecture in general or design and style larger-scale software answers. As well as programming, they may be answerable for tasks connected to info analytics, tests, and scaling.

You may first receive a task for a junior software developer ahead of moving into senior or direct developer positions, and then later on advancing to administration positions.

This evolution has long been pushed by technological advancements, modifying wants, as well as rising complexity with the digital world. Let's take a look at The crucial element levels from the evolution of software development. Desk of Conten

Accomplishing demands analysis and functional unit checks to establish gaps along with other probable problems

Software builders Have a very much less formal part than engineers and can be intently involved with unique venture spots — which includes producing code. Simultaneously, they push the general software development lifecycle — which include Operating throughout practical teams to rework needs into capabilities, control development groups and processes, and carry out software screening and maintenance.3

Software development performs a crucial job in our day by day life. It empowers smartphone apps and supports corporations around the world. Software builders build the software, which alone is usually a

Underneath Software Development, developers create all the software that comes underneath these 3 group.

Recognizing more empowers leaders to utilize engineering proficiently, make knowledgeable decisions about software investments, and communicate much more effectively with development groups. Let us soar to the basics.

Applications more info also make reference to web and cell programs like those accustomed to store on Amazon.com, socialize with Facebook or write-up photographs to Instagram.1

Report this page